Output b588d8a66fbd5906dd5ef9939cdbca894905413163002afd3b35c69d7e003182:16

value
337659
script pubkey
OP_0 OP_PUSHBYTES_32 28d8b1cebbf1c27a297be6e537ec29004255b9b3294a13aee3eb247aa5d81fed
address
bc1q9rvtrn4m78p852tmumjn0mpfqpp9twdn999p8thravj84fwcrlksph7tha
transaction
b588d8a66fbd5906dd5ef9939cdbca894905413163002afd3b35c69d7e003182